1
0
mirror of https://github.com/DCC-EX/CommandStation-EX.git synced 2025-06-20 14:15:24 +02:00

Compare commits

..

1 Commits

2 changed files with 5 additions and 9 deletions

View File

@ -1,9 +1,7 @@
/* /*
* © 2024, Paul Antoine * © 2023, Neil McKechnie. All rights reserved.
* © 2023, Neil McKechnie
* All rights reserved.
* *
* This file is part of DCC-EX API * This file is part of DCC++EX API
* *
* This is free software: you can redistribute it and/or modify * This is free software: you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by * it under the terms of the GNU General Public License as published by
@ -114,14 +112,13 @@ protected:
// Fill buffer with spaces // Fill buffer with spaces
memset(_buffer, ' ', _numCols*_numRows); memset(_buffer, ' ', _numCols*_numRows);
_displayDriver->clearNative();
// Add device to list of HAL devices (not necessary but allows // Add device to list of HAL devices (not necessary but allows
// status to be displayed using <D HAL SHOW> and device to be // status to be displayed using <D HAL SHOW> and device to be
// reinitialised using <D HAL RESET>). // reinitialised using <D HAL RESET>).
IODevice::addDevice(this); IODevice::addDevice(this);
// Moved after addDevice() to ensure I2CManager.begin() has been called fisrt
_displayDriver->clearNative();
// Also add this display to list of display handlers // Also add this display to list of display handlers
DisplayInterface::addDisplay(displayNo); DisplayInterface::addDisplay(displayNo);

View File

@ -3,8 +3,7 @@
#include "StringFormatter.h" #include "StringFormatter.h"
#define VERSION "5.2.48" #define VERSION "5.2.47"
// 5.2.48 - Bugfix: HALDisplay was generating I2C traffic prior to I2C being initialised
// 5.2.47 - EXRAIL additions: // 5.2.47 - EXRAIL additions:
// STEALTH_GLOBAL // STEALTH_GLOBAL
// BLINK // BLINK